This review is from: Heart Surgeon's Little Instruction Book (Paperback)
This is a highly entertaining and educational book with many short little one-liners that reflect the practice of the art, and has many handy tips that we have already heard before from our consultants - now all collected into one small book.
Contains over 400 quotations. Examples include:
Despite frantic urgings from the referring physician, avoid operating on dead people.
If the pupils remain small, the soul usually cannot escape.
These quotations are classified into several sections- Preoperative Operative & techniques Postops Residents & other fellows Colleagues and other strangers.
It is very easy reading, and can be finished within half an hour.
